But Pip is taken away from this simple working class association with the wealthy, strange Miss Haversham, he is taught to look down on himself and his he is later funded(資助 )to leave this life and trained in London to be a“gentleman”, the friendship he enjoyed with Joe will never be the same again. This dark novel continues to appeal to readers because there are possibly millions of Pips in the experience of being driven from your background, the experience of having your loved ones drift apart (疏遠 )from you and even look down on you because they must“get on in the world”has not gone away.
